SCHEDULE: BlackRock Boosts Allegiant Travel Stake to 10.6%
Beneficial Ownership Report
BlackRock, Inc. has reported a 10.6% beneficial ownership stake in Allegiant Travel Company, holding 1,951,232 common shares as of September 30, 2025.
Summary
- BlackRock, Inc. filed an Amendment No. 4 to Schedule 13G, disclosing its beneficial ownership in Allegiant Travel Company.
- As of September 30, 2025, BlackRock, Inc. beneficially owns 1,951,232 shares of Allegiant Travel Company's Common Stock.
- This ownership represents 10.6% of the total class of securities.
- BlackRock, Inc. holds sole voting power over 1,923,471 shares and sole dispositive power over 1,951,232 shares.
- No shared voting or dispositive power is reported.
- The securities were acquired and are held in the ordinary course of business, not for the purpose of changing or influencing control of Allegiant Travel Company.
- BlackRock Fund Advisors, a subsidiary of BlackRock, Inc., beneficially owns 5% or greater of the outstanding shares of the security class.
